
Центральний процесор (CPU) — це основний обчислювальний компонент комп’ютера, який відповідає за виконання інструкцій програм та розподіл ресурсів. У середовищі блокчейну CPU здійснює перевірку даних, обробку криптографічних підписів і підтримку мережевої взаємодії.
Вузлом називають комп’ютер, що бере участь у блокчейн-мережі. CPU кожного вузла перевіряє блоки й транзакції, забезпечуючи прийняття даних згідно з протоколом. "Хеш" — це цифровий відбиток, сформований алгоритмом із даних, який необхідний для перевірки та досягнення консенсусу. "Підпис" — це цифрове підтвердження, що транзакцію справді ініціював власник активу.
CPU на ланцюгу відповідає за перевірку, виконання та координацію. Він підтверджує легітимність блоків і транзакцій, обробляє смартконтракти та керує взаємодією мережі зі сховищем.
У Bitcoin CPU пакетно перевіряє підписи транзакцій, підтверджуючи авторизацію приватним ключем. В Ethereum шар виконання запускає логіку контрактів і оновлює стан, а шар консенсусу керує голосуванням — обидва процеси потребують стабільної роботи CPU.
У Proof of Stake (PoS) мережах валідатори використовують CPU для пакування та перевірки інформації; відключення впливає на винагороди й репутацію. У Proof of Work (PoW) системах майнінг здійснюють ASIC або GPU, але CPU керує перевіркою вузлів і мережевими процесами.
CPU універсальний — він виконує багатозадачні й складні логічні операції. GPU — це паралельна архітектура з багатьма обчислювальними потоками, оптимальна для масових і повторюваних розрахунків, таких як пакетне хешування чи графічна обробка. ASIC — це спеціалізований пристрій для конкретної задачі, наприклад PoW-майнінгу, з максимальною ефективністю.
У блокчейн-системах CPU відповідає за логіку протоколу, перевірку даних і розподіл завдань. GPU краще підходять для паралельних операцій, як-от генерація доказів із нульовим розголошенням чи відтворення даних. ASIC орієнтовані на конкретні майнінгові алгоритми. Вибір обладнання залежить від гнучкості завдань, бюджету та енергоспоживання.
Легкі вузли мають мінімальні вимоги до CPU, а повні вузли й валідатори потребують більшої продуктивності. Достатність CPU визначається цільовою мережею, очікуваним навантаженням і кількістю клієнтів.
Крок 1: Визначте цільову мережу та роль. Повні вузли, архівні вузли й валідатори мають різні вимоги — орієнтуйтесь на офіційні апаратні стандарти проєкту (Ethereum, Bitcoin, Solana) станом на 2024 рік.
Крок 2: Оцініть навантаження й піковий попит. Врахуйте синхронізацію, пікові навантаження, швидке відновлення після перезапуску, а також паралельну роботу моніторингу, логування та резервного копіювання.
Крок 3: Оберіть кількість ядер і частоту. Більше ядер — це краща паралельна перевірка; вища частота — менша затримка на транзакцію чи мережеве повідомлення. Для PoS-валідаторів оптимально використовувати багатоядерні CPU із середньою або високою частотою для стабільної пропускної здатності.
Крок 4: Забезпечте достатню пам’ять і сховище. Недостатньо RAM — CPU простоює, синхронізація ускладнюється; швидкі SSD покращують доступ до стану й індексацію. Важливий баланс системи, а не окремого компонента.
Для безперервної роботи важливі належне охолодження та резервне живлення. Перегрів чи збої призводять до штрафів і втрати винагороди.
Докази із нульовим розголошенням дозволяють підтвердити інформацію без її розкриття. Генерація таких доказів — це обчислювально складний процес; перевірка, навпаки, легша. CPU використовується для локальної генерації малих доказів і для перевірки на вузлі чи в ланцюгу.
Для великих навантажень застосовують GPU для прискорення генерації доказів або спеціалізовані бібліотеки для паралельних обчислень. CPU залишається відповідальним за координацію завдань, серіалізацію даних і виконання послідовних етапів. CPU із векторними інструкціями (SIMD) і високою пропускною здатністю пам’яті прискорює генерацію доказів.
Станом на 2024 рік більшість проєктів генерують докази поза ланцюгом або на обчислювальних кластерах, а результати надсилають у блокчейн. CPU вузла головно відповідає за перевірку й пакування, знижуючи навантаження на одну машину.
Для ініціації транзакції гаманець підписує її; CPU формує дані для підпису й викликає модулі підпису. Якщо підписування відбувається на телефоні чи комп’ютері, важливі безпека системи й шлях виконання CPU.
Найкраща практика — зберігати приватні ключі у відокремлених апаратних середовищах, таких як захищені елементи чи Trusted Execution Environment (TEE). CPU направляє запити в ці "анклави" й отримує результат без доступу до приватних ключів.
Ризики: шкідливе ПЗ може змусити користувача підтвердити зловмисну транзакцію або використати вразливість системи для обходу ізоляції. Захист — перевіряти деталі транзакції, використовувати мультипідписи чи порогові схеми (MPC), регулярно оновлювати систему. Для операцій із коштами починайте з малих тестів і зберігайте резервні копії офлайн.
Хмарні сервери — це гнучкість і швидкий запуск; локальне обладнання — контроль і стабільна затримка. Вибір залежить від цілей доступності, бюджету й вимог до відповідності.
Крок 1: Визначте цілі й обмеження. Врахуйте потребу у високій доступності між регіонами, обмеження щодо відповідності чи наднизьку затримку (наприклад, для "frontrunning" стратегій).
Крок 2: Оцініть продуктивність і витрати. У хмарних vCPU базова й пікова продуктивність впливають на стабільність; локальне обладнання вимагає початкових вкладень і постійних витрат на електроенергію та обслуговування. Порівнюйте повну вартість володіння за 3–6 місяців.
Крок 3: Зверніть увагу на архітектурні особливості. Віддавайте перевагу CPU зі стабільною частотою, великим кешем і пропускною здатністю пам’яті; для багатовузлових розгортань враховуйте конфігурації NUMA й прив’язку потоків для уникнення затримок між сокетами.
Крок 4: Плануйте резервування й моніторинг. Для хмари чи локального обладнання забезпечте гарячі резерви, сповіщення й автоматичне відновлення для реагування на навантаження чи відмови апаратури.
Під час роботи з ринковими даними чи торговими API Gate продуктивність CPU визначає швидкість перевірки ризиків, декодування даних і розрахунків стратегій. Стабільний CPU мінімізує втрату пакетів і ризик накопичення черг, забезпечуючи передбачувану затримку для високочастотної обробки даних.
Під час бектестування чи моніторингу в реальному часі потужність CPU визначає, скільки стратегій можна запускати одночасно й наскільки швидко обробляються кожна свічка чи торговий евент. Для аналізу впливу подій у ланцюгу на ринок CPU має ефективно отримувати й очищати багатоджерельні дані, щоб панелі й сповіщення залишалися оперативними.
Всі торгові й кількісні операції несуть ринкові й системні ризики. Впроваджуйте ліміти, "circuit breakers" (механізми зупинки), контроль ризиків; розгортайте поступово — від тестового середовища чи малих обсягів, щоб уникнути втрат через помилки ПЗ чи апаратні обмеження.
Основні ризики: недостатня продуктивність, що призводить до затримок синхронізації, невдалих перевірок чи пропущених вікон генерації блоків; збої апаратури або ПЗ, які спричиняють простої; шкідливе ПЗ, що загрожує процесу підпису; перегрів і шум. Витрати включають придбання обладнання або оренду хмари, електроенергію та обслуговування.
Для валідаторів особливо важливі штрафні механізми й безпека застейканих активів. Підготуйте резервні вузли, надійні системи сповіщення, автоматичне перемикання й регулярно тестуйте плани відновлення, щоб мінімізувати фінансові чи репутаційні втрати через відмову одного компонента.
CPU — це базовий обчислювальний ресурс блокчейн-систем. Він забезпечує перевірку, виконання й координацію, впливає на стабільність вузла, безпеку підпису гаманця й ефективність розробки. Порівняно з GPU чи ASIC CPU більш гнучкий для логіки протоколу й багатозадачності; GPU чи зовнішні сервіси виконують паралельні завдання, як-от генерація доказів із нульовим розголошенням чи відтворення даних, але CPU залишається основним для координації й послідовних обчислень. Вибирайте обладнання відповідно до ролі у цільовому ланцюгу, балансуючи частоту, кількість ядер, пам’ять, сховище; оцінюйте продуктивність щодо вартості й доступності при виборі між хмарою чи локальним варіантом. Завжди налаштовуйте резервування й контроль ризиків для фінансових операцій; починайте з малого й масштабуйтесь відповідально.
Вимоги до CPU залежать від блокчейну, типу вузла й складності мережі. Повні вузли зазвичай потребують багатоядерних CPU з високою частотою для перевірки транзакцій; легкі вузли мають менші вимоги. Перед придбанням обладнання уважно ознайомтеся з документацією обраного блокчейну.
Спеціалізовані чипи, такі як ASIC, оптимізовані для конкретних алгоритмів — вони забезпечують набагато кращу енергоефективність, ніж універсальні CPU, що дає вищий дохід від майнінгу. CPU більш універсальні й мають нижчий поріг входу, тому підходять для тестового майнінгу в малих масштабах. Вибір залежить від бюджету й технічних можливостей.
Обмеження CPU впливають на швидкість обробки й зручність, але не загрожують безпеці коштів. Якщо програмне забезпечення гаманця якісне, а управління приватним ключем відповідає найкращим практикам — навіть на малопотужних пристроях кошти залишаються захищеними. Постійні затримки можуть призвести до помилок; для безпеки використовуйте швидкі пристрої при здійсненні транзакцій.
Веб-платформа Gate має низькі вимоги до локального CPU — сучасні браузери справляються з цим на більшості комп’ютерів. Для локальних кількісних інструментів чи API у високочастотній торгівлі потужніший CPU знижує ризик затримки й підвищує ефективність виконання стратегій.


